@keyframes PromotionTags_pulse-animation__nwVcj{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.PromotionTags_promotionTags__HLTYY{display:flex;gap:.5rem;list-style:none;padding:0}.PromotionTags_promotionTagsVertical__mA5SA{flex-direction:column}@keyframes Tooltip_pulse-animation__sUzrc{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.Tooltip_tooltip__FODmF{cursor:pointer;display:inline-block;line-height:1;position:relative}.Tooltip_tooltip__FODmF:after,.Tooltip_tooltip__FODmF:before{opacity:0;pointer-events:none;position:absolute;transition:opacity .3s cubic-bezier(.5,0,.4,1),transform .3s cubic-bezier(.5,0,.4,1)}.Tooltip_tooltip__FODmF:before{border-style:solid;border-width:.25rem;content:""}.Tooltip_tooltip__FODmF:after{font-family:Scala Sans Pro Regular,Segoe UI,Roboto,Helvetica Neue,sans-serif;font-size:.875rem;font-weight:400;letter-spacing:.01875rem;line-height:1.5rem;background-color:var(--primaryColor);border-radius:.125rem;color:var(--secondaryColor);content:attr(data-tooltip);max-width:11.5rem;padding:.3125rem .5rem;text-align:center;white-space:break-word;width:max-content;z-index:1}.Tooltip_tooltip__FODmF:focus:after,.Tooltip_tooltip__FODmF:focus:before,.Tooltip_tooltip__FODmF:hover:after,.Tooltip_tooltip__FODmF:hover:before{opacity:1;pointer-events:auto}.Tooltip_tooltip__FODmF.Tooltip_tooltip-top__G5zhd:before{border-color:var(--primaryColor) transparent transparent transparent;left:50%;margin-left:-.25rem;top:-50%;transform:translateY(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-top__G5zhd:after{bottom:150%;left:50%;transform:translate(-50%,2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-top__G5zhd: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-top__G5zhd:hover:before{transform:translateY(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-top__G5zhd: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-top__G5zhd:hover:after{transform:translate(-50%)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-topLeft__I1eds:before{border-color:var(--primaryColor) transparent transparent transparent;left:50%;margin-left:-.25rem;top:-50%;transform:translateY(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-topLeft__I1eds:after{bottom:150%;left:calc(50% - (1rem));text-align:left;transform:translateY(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-topLeft__I1eds: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-topLeft__I1eds: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-topLeft__I1eds:hover: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-topLeft__I1eds:hover:before{transform:translateY(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-topRight__DpS1w:before{border-color:var(--primaryColor) transparent transparent transparent;left:50%;margin-left:-.25rem;top:-50%;transform:translateY(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-topRight__DpS1w:after{bottom:150%;right:calc(50% - (1rem));text-align:right;transform:translateY(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-topRight__DpS1w: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-topRight__DpS1w: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-topRight__DpS1w:hover: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-topRight__DpS1w:hover:before{transform:translateY(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ottom__OjaUk:before{border-color:transparent transparent var(--primaryColor) transparent;bottom:-50%;left:50%;margin-left:-.25rem;transform:translateY(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ottom__OjaUk:after{left:50%;top:150%;transform:translate(-50%,-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ottom__OjaUk: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ottom__OjaUk:hover:before{transform:translateY(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ottom__OjaUk: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ottom__OjaUk:hover:after{transform:translate(-50%)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omLeft__Iqaon:before{border-color:transparent transparent var(--primaryColor) transparent;bottom:-50%;left:50%;margin-left:-.25rem;transform:translateY(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omLeft__Iqaon:after{left:calc(50% - (1rem));text-align:left;top:150%;transform:translateY(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omLeft__Iqaon: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omLeft__Iqaon: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omLeft__Iqaon:hover: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omLeft__Iqaon:hover:before{transform:translateY(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omRight__yfvBE:before{border-color:transparent transparent var(--primaryColor) transparent;bottom:-50%;left:50%;margin-left:-.25rem;transform:translateY(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omRight__yfvBE:after{right:calc(50% - (1rem));text-align:right;top:150%;transform:translateY(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omRight__yfvBE: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omRight__yfvBE: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omRight__yfvBE:hover: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-bottomRight__yfvBE:hover:before{transform:translateY(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-left__3nDUq:before{border-color:transparent transparent transparent var(--primaryColor);margin-top:-.25rem;right:calc(110% - 4px);top:.5rem;transform:translateX(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-left__3nDUq:after{right:calc(110% + 4px);top:-.25rem;transform:translateX(2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-left__3nDUq: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-left__3nDUq: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-left__3nDUq:hover: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-left__3nDUq:hover:before{transform:translateX(0)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-right__akxkY:before{border-color:transparent var(--primaryColor) transparent transparent;left:calc(110% - 4px);margin-top:-.25rem;top:.5rem;transform:translateX(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-right__akxkY:after{left:calc(110% + 4px);top:-.25rem;transform:translateX(-2px)}.Tooltip_tooltip__FODmF.Tooltip_tooltip-right__akxkY:focus: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-right__akxkY:focus:before,.Tooltip_tooltip__FODmF.Tooltip_tooltip-right__akxkY:hover:after,.Tooltip_tooltip__FODmF.Tooltip_tooltip-right__akxkY:hover:before{transform:translateX(0)}.Tooltip_tooltip__FODmF.Tooltip_light__rUrkN{--primaryColor:#1a1919;--secondaryColor:#fff}.Tooltip_tooltip__FODmF.Tooltip_dark__jfSYt{--primaryColor:#666666;--secondaryColor:#fff}.InfoTooltip_infoToolTip__c_yYE path{fill:var(--primaryColor)}@keyframes InputAndSelectionLabel_pulse-animation__z_By5{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.InputAndSelectionLabel_inputAndSelectionLabel__WLwPS{color:var(--labelColor);font-family:Scala Sans Pro Regular,Segoe UI,Roboto,Helvetica Neue,sans-serif;font-size:1rem;font-weight:400;letter-spacing:.0375rem;line-height:1.5rem}.InputAndSelectionLabel_inputAndSelectionLabel__WLwPS.InputAndSelectionLabel_light__h1Lxe{--labelColor:#1a1919}.InputAndSelectionLabel_inputAndSelectionLabel__WLwPS.InputAndSelectionLabel_dark__oibdN{--labelColor:#fff}@keyframes TextFieldLabel_pulse-animation__GICvF{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.TextFieldLabel_textFieldLabel__ak49n{align-items:center;display:flex;gap:.5rem}@keyframes QuantitySelector_pulse-animation__W9vqg{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.QuantitySelector_quantitySelector__tqge4{align-items:center;display:grid;grid-template-columns:min-content max-content min-content;z-index:1}@media (min-width:1024px){.QuantitySelector_quantitySelector__tqge4{grid-template-columns:3rem 3.625rem 3rem;row-gap:.25rem}}.QuantitySelector_quantitySelectorWithCTA__e78m6{grid-template-columns:min-content min-content auto min-content}@media (min-width:1024px){.QuantitySelector_quantitySelectorWithCTA__e78m6{grid-template-columns:3rem 3.625rem 3rem;grid-template-rows:min-content min-content}}.QuantitySelector_quantitySelectorInputContainer__uFVQ4{width:100%}@media (min-width:1024px){.QuantitySelector_quantitySelectorInputContainer__uFVQ4{width:3.625rem}}.QuantitySelector_quantitySelectorInput__ToK1Z{-webkit-appearance:textfield;-moz-appearance:textfield;appearance:textfield;border-radius:unset;text-align:center}.QuantitySelector_quantitySelectorInput__ToK1Z::-webkit-inner-spin-button,.QuantitySelector_quantitySelectorInput__ToK1Z::-webkit-outer-spin-button{-webkit-appearance:none;appearance:none;margin:0}.QuantitySelector_quantitySelectorInput__ToK1Z:focus,.QuantitySelector_quantitySelectorInput__ToK1Z:hover{position:relative;z-index:2}.QuantitySelector_quantitySelectorInputError__H8mf_,.QuantitySelector_quantitySelectorInputValid__zrjNw{position:relative;z-index:3}.QuantitySelector_quantitySelectorInputValid__zrjNw{padding-right:1rem}.QuantitySelector_quantitySelectorDecrement__9NfJr{border-bottom-right-radius:unset;border-top-right-radius:unset;border-color:#cccccc transparent #cccccc #cccccc;margin-right:-1px;width:3rem;z-index:1}.QuantitySelector_quantitySelectorDecrement__9NfJr:disabled{position:static;z-index:0}.QuantitySelector_quantitySelectorIncrement__Cfr68{border-bottom-left-radius:unset;border-top-left-radius:unset;border-color:#cccccc #cccccc #cccccc transparent;margin-left:-1px;width:3rem;z-index:1}.QuantitySelector_quantitySelectorIncrement__Cfr68:disabled{position:static;z-index:0}.QuantitySelector_quantitySelectorCTA__UUiRK{grid-area:1/1;margin:0 .75rem;white-space:nowrap}@media (min-width:1024px){.QuantitySelector_quantitySelectorCTA__UUiRK{display:flex;grid-column:1/span 3;grid-row:2;margin:unset}}.QuantitySelector_quantitySelectorCTALink__8Adc4{margin:0 auto}@keyframes ProductItem_pulse-animation__MDW8V{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.ProductItem_productItem__weD0Y{grid-column-gap:.5rem;column-gap:.5rem;display:grid;grid-template-areas:var(--gridTemplateMobile,"promotionTags promotionTags" "image productContentContainer" "productQuantitySelector productQuantitySelector" "giftMessage giftMessage" "notifications notifications");grid-template-columns:5.625rem 1fr;position:relative;grid-row-gap:1rem;row-gap:1rem;width:100%}@media (min-width:1024px){.ProductItem_productItem__weD0Y{column-gap:1rem;grid-template-areas:var(--gridTemplateDesktop,"promotionTags promotionTags" "image productContentContainer" "giftMessage giftMessage" "notifications notifications")}}.ProductItem_productItemPromotionTags__b_nrY{grid-area:promotionTags}.ProductItem_productItemImage__FVwzY{align-self:center;grid-area:image}.ProductItem_productItemImageLink__9_7_U{cursor:pointer}.ProductItem_productItemImageWhite__kC_0L{background-color:#fff}.ProductItem_productItemImageSand__Ngv8H{background-color:#faf9f7}.ProductItem_productItemContentContainer__EW6g4{align-self:center;grid-column-gap:.5rem;column-gap:.5rem;display:grid;grid-area:productContentContainer;grid-template-areas:var(--gridContentTemplateMobile,"productContent productPriceOrRibbon");grid-template-columns:var(--gridContentTemplateColumnsMobile,1fr min-content);height:min-content}@media (min-width:1024px){.ProductItem_productItemContentContainer__EW6g4{column-gap:1rem;grid-template-areas:var(--gridContentTemplateDesktop,"productContent productQuantitySelector productPriceOrRibbon");grid-template-columns:var(--gridContentTemplateColumnsDesktop,1fr min-content min-content)}}.ProductItem_productItemContent__cyxHs{grid-area:productContent}.ProductItem_productItemPrice__qKqV3{grid-area:productPriceOrRibbon}.ProductItem_productItemPriceFree__9uEEy{color:#1a1919;font-family:ClassGarmnd BT,Times New Roman,serif;font-weight:400;font-size:1rem;line-height:1.5rem}@media (min-width:1024px){.ProductItem_productItemPriceFree__9uEEy{font-size:1.25rem;line-height:1.75rem}}.ProductItem_productItemPriceFree__9uEEy{text-align:right}.ProductItem_productItemQuantitySelector__5o1qQ{align-content:flex-start;grid-area:productQuantitySelector;width:-moz-fit-content;width:fit-content}.ProductItem_productItemRibbon__hbOl_{max-width:3.375rem;position:absolute;right:0;top:0}.ProductItem_productItemGiftMessage__Lzpml{grid-area:giftMessage}.ProductItem_productItemNotifications__YT8tx{grid-area:notifications}@keyframes StockNotification_pulse-animation__8uYm8{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.StockNotification_stockNotification__MpbVa{align-items:baseline;display:flex;gap:.25rem}.StockNotification_stockNotificationDot__IiUDR{margin-top:.25rem}.StockNotification_stockNotificationDotInStock__81RlK{background-color:#007e33}.StockNotification_stockNotificationDotLimitedStock__uQiNe{background-color:#666666}.StockNotification_stockNotificationDotOutOfStock__HNHMH{background-color:#c04416}.StockNotification_stockNotificationContent__OWxO2{color:#1a1919}@keyframes ProductContent_pulse-animation__W9_FD{0%{box-shadow:0 0 0 0 rgba(0,0,0,.2)}to{box-shadow:0 0 0 1.25rem rgba(0,0,0,0)}}.ProductContent_productContent__xnl9q{display:flex;flex-direction:column;gap:.25rem}.ProductContent_productContentHeading__dk4tu{margin-bottom:.25rem}.ProductContent_productContentHeadingButton__orOXR{background-color:transparent;border:none;cursor:pointer;display:inline-block;padding:unset}.ProductContent_productContentHeadingButton__orOXR:hover{text-decoration:underline}.ProductContent_productContentQuantity__3xr2w{align-items:baseline;display:grid;grid-gap:.75rem;gap:.75rem;grid-template-columns:auto auto;place-content:baseline}.ProductContent_productContentCtaList__vu6_P{display:flex;gap:1rem;list-style:none;margin:0;padding:0}
/*# sourceMappingURL=2c80dbe7d53b574b.css.map*/